Environmental Health and Safety Specialist Jobs in Ohio

An Environmental Health and Safety Specialist is a professional who focuses on identifying and eliminating risks in the workplace. They work in a wide range of sectors, especially in industries like manufacturing, construction, and healthcare that involve substantial physical activities. They are responsible for ensuring that an organization complies with environmental policies and laws to prevent accidents and protect the health of employees and the environment. This involves conducting regular inspections and audits, implementing safety training programs, and maintaining documentation of all environmental health and safety-related activities.

Key skills required for this role include a strong understanding of environmental regulations, excellent communication and analytical skills, and the ability to handle emergency situations. They must also possess certifications such as Certified Safety Professional (CSP) or Certified Industrial Hygienist (CIH), depending on the specific industry requirements. Relevant Bachelor's degrees in Environmental Health, Safety Engineering, or Occupational Health are often required. Prior to becoming an Environmental Health and Safety Specialist, individuals might have roles such as Safety Coordinator, Environmental Technician, or Health and Safety Advisor.

Highest Education Level

Environmental Health and Safety Specialists in Ohio offer the following education background
Bachelor's Degree
50.7%
Master's Degree
27.4%
Associate's Degree
6.1%
High School or GED
5.6%
Vocational Degree or Certification
5.5%
Doctorate Degree
3.8%
Some College
0.8%
Some High School
0.1%
